Kinloch is a single-family community on Naperville's south side, set in the Will County portion of the city. It took shape among the higher-end planned neighborhoods that filled in south of the older city core, offering large custom homes on generous lots.
The homes are predominantly substantial two-story custom designs, set on lots sized for room and privacy, arranged around landscaped common areas. That scale of home places Kinloch toward the upper end of the south Naperville market.
Residents are close to the Route 59 corridor for shopping and dining, the forest preserve and trail network of south Naperville, and the I-55 corridor for regional travel. Downtown Naperville, the Riverwalk, and the BNSF Metra station are a short drive north.
